Pennsylvania Regulations § 7.177 Notification of the Secretary of Administration

Up to Subchapter K: Code of Conduct for Appointed Officials and State Employees

Regulation Text

When an employe has been charged with criminal conduct, the agency head or his designee shall immediately notify the Secretary of Administration of the name and position of the employe, the criminal charges against the employe, and of the initiation of any agency investigation. Action taken with regard to the employment status of the employe and the disposition of the criminal charges shall also be reported to the Secretary of Administration.

History

The provisions of this § 7.177 amended by Executive Order No. 1980-18, dated and effective 5/16/1984 , 14 Pa.B. 2036.
